by Sergei Lukyanenko
publisher: Harper Paperbacks publish date: 2014-04-22
format: paperback pages: 384
language: English
ISBN:
0062310070 (9780062310071)
ASIN: 62310070
publisher: William Heinemann publish date: March 7th 2013
format: hardcover pages: 416
language: English
ISBN:
0434022314 (9780434022311)
publisher: William Heinemann publish date: May 2nd 2013
format: kindle pages: 416
language: English
ISBN:
0434022241 (9780434022243)
publisher: Arrow publish date: March 27th 2014
format: paperback pages: 416
language: English
ISBN:
0099580144 (9780099580140)
publisher: Cornerstone Digital publish date: 2013-05-02
format: kindle pages: 420
language: English
ASIN: B00BMQDM2O
publisher: Cornerstone Digital publish date: May 2nd 2013
format: ebook pages: 416
language: English
ISBN:
1448149835 (9781448149834)
publisher: Doubleday Canada publish date: April 22nd 2014
format: ebook pages: 496
language: English
ISBN:
0385681798 (9780385681797)
publisher: Harper Paperbacks publish date: April 22nd 2014
format: ebook pages: 416
language: English
ISBN:
0062310089 (9780062310088)
format: paperback pages: 416
language: English
ISBN:
038568178X (9780385681780)